| How
much should I get paid? |
|
As much as people will pay you. Professional solo artists get
$150+ for a single 10-15 minute set. What you're worth depends
on what tools you know, how well you use them, the overall performance
presence you bring to the art and how well you can market yourself.
The best way to start out is to talk to everyone you know and
tell them what you do. Leave business cards where ever you go;
suggest a performance at events you know friends are throwing;
register to agencies who promote fire artists, including the new
Temple of Poi Artists
section; advertise on the mailing lists you can share that
information on; and look for postings on the internet (Tribe is
an excellent place to look) where gig opportunities appear.
